Abkürzung "^^"

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• Abkürzung "^^"

    Hi,

    hab letztens sowas hier gesehen:

    GML-Quellcode

    1. if (​keycheck_left ^^ keycheck_right)


    Jemand ne Ahnung wofür das "^^" steht? Ist sicher ne Abkürzung wie || oder &&.

    Hab sowas noch nie gesehen, gibts eigentlich ne Liste zu allen "Abkürzungen"?
    Imagine taking your usual two century long nap minding your own business when suddenly some cunt wakes you up.
    You tell him to f*ck off of course but just when you finally managed to fall asleep again the same asshole comes knocking again. I'd attack that dick too.
  • Dies ist ein xor operator, das heißt in so einem beispiel:

    if (keycheck_left ^^ keycheck_right)
    {
    // do code 1
    }

    es wird nur etwas tun wenn entweder keycheck_left ODER keycheck_right true ist.
    Sollten beide Bedingungen "true" ausspucken, wird beim xor der boolean Wert "false" ausgespuckt.

    In die normale Sprache übersetzt heißt es "entweder, oder"

    Anders im Code umzusetzen wäre dies so:


    if(keycheck_left == true)&&(keycheck_right == false)
    {
    // do code1
    }

    if(keycheck_right == true)&&(keycheck_left == false)
    {
    // do code 1
    }